Total Cost of Ownership — Electric vs Petrol Scooter
Understanding the full financial picture is key when comparing an electric scooter with a petrol scooter. While the initial purchase price might sometimes be comparable, the long-term ownership economics favour electric over typical multi-year horizons.
- Purchase Cost: Electric scooters often have a competitive upfront cost, especially with various models available. Petrol scooters also vary widely based on brand and features.
- Running Cost: Electric scooter charging at home offers a meaningfully lower per-kilometre cost compared to the fluctuating prices of petrol.
- Maintenance Expenses: Petrol scooters typically require routine engine maintenance, oil changes, and fuel filter replacements. Electric scooters, with their simpler drivetrain, generally incur fewer scheduled service visits.
- Residual Value: Both types of scooters hold value, but the evolving market and demand for sustainable options could impact future resale trends.

Maintenance & Service Burden
The difference in maintenance requirements between an electric scooter and a petrol scooter is significant. A petrol scooter's complex internal combustion engine necessitates regular oil changes, spark plug replacements, air filter cleaning, and periodic tune-ups to ensure efficient operation. This often translates to more frequent service appointments and associated costs.
Conversely, an electric scooter features a much simpler drivetrain with fewer moving parts. There's no engine oil to change, no spark plugs, and no fuel filters. Maintenance for an electric scooter primarily involves checking brakes, tires, and general wear and tear, along with occasional software updates. This results in fewer scheduled service visits and a generally lower overall maintenance burden for the owner.
